So, 'Paradise of Paradise' – it’s an interesting blend of fantasy that pulls you into a world where memory and music intertwine. The pacing has this dreamlike quality, almost like drifting through a half-remembered dream. The composer’s journey back to his childhood is richly layered, and you can really sense the longing in his quest. The characters he meets, like the wild samurai and the enigmatic king, are memorable in their own right, adding this whimsical yet slightly dark atmosphere. The practical effects have a certain charm, and although the director remains unknown, the performances really bring the story to life. It’s distinctive in how it explores themes of creativity and nostalgia, which feels quite profound.
